What Clean My Past does
The software screens your facts against state-specific rules, prepares supported forms, organizes filing instructions, and tracks deadlines. You remain the self-represented filer.
Expungement
Learn how expungement works, which states Clean My Past supports, what it costs, and how software-guided filing differs from hiring a lawyer.
Expungement is a state-specific process for clearing or limiting access to a criminal record. Clean My Past helps people in 8 states check whether a software-guided expungement or related record-clearing path may fit.
The software screens your facts against state-specific rules, prepares supported forms, organizes filing instructions, and tracks deadlines. You remain the self-represented filer.
Complex cases, disputed facts, immigration consequences, active warrants, open cases, or unusual criminal history should be reviewed by a licensed attorney or legal aid provider.
Even after a record is cleared by a court or state agency, private background-check companies may continue reporting stale data. FCRA disputes help force reinvestigation.
FAQ
No. Every state uses its own terms, forms, waiting periods, and eligibility rules. Clean My Past currently supports 8 launch states.
No. Courts, agencies, and statutes control outcomes. Software can organize the process and paperwork but cannot guarantee a result.
Last reviewed 2026-05-12. Clean My Past is software, not a law firm, and does not provide legal advice.